Brainstorming Across the Four Buckets

Organize your thoughts using the four material buckets: background, achievements, gap, and personality.

  • Background: Reflect on experiences that have shaped your desire to pursue nursing. Consider personal stories, family influences, or significant events.
  • Achievements: List your academic accomplishments, relevant work or volunteer experiences, and any leadership roles. Use metrics or specific outcomes to illustrate your impact.
  • The Gap: Identify any challenges or gaps in your education or experience that the scholarship will help you overcome. Explain why further study is essential for your career plans.
  • Personality: Share details that reveal your character. What values drive you? How do you approach challenges? This section should humanize your application.

Drafting Voice and Style

As you draft, aim for an active voice. Instead of saying, “The nursing program was pursued,” write, “I pursued the nursing program.” Be specific and avoid vague statements. Each paragraph should focus on one main idea, and ensure that your writing flows logically from one point to the next.

Revision & “So What?”

After drafting, take a break before revising. Read your essay critically: Does it answer the prompt? Does it reflect your unique journey and aspirations? Each section should answer the question, “So what?”—clarifying why your experiences matter and how they connect to your future in nursing.

Pitfalls to Avoid

Be mindful of common pitfalls in scholarship essays:

  • Avoid clichés and generic statements. Start with a compelling, specific moment.
  • Refrain from using passive voice where an active subject exists.
  • Do not fabricate experiences or achievements; authenticity is key.
  • Steer clear of overly emotional language; focus instead on clarity and impact.

FAQ

What is the Mildred Fite Memorial Nursing Scholarship?
The Mildred Fite Memorial Nursing Scholarship is offered by Florida Gateway College to assist students with education costs in the nursing program. The award amount varies.
Who is eligible to apply for this scholarship?
This scholarship is geared toward students attending Florida Gateway College who are pursuing a nursing education.
When is the application deadline?
The application deadline for the Mildred Fite Memorial Nursing Scholarship is May 1, 2026.
